Spicy Turkey Chili Serve with Cornbread or Baked Tortilla Chips
6 - 7 ounces hot turkey Italian sausage Heat a large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Remove casings from sausage. Add sausage, onion, and the next 4 ingredients (onion through jalapeño) to pan; cook 8 minutes or until sausage and beef are browned, stirring to crumble. Add chili powder and the next 7 ingredients (chili powder through bay leaves), and cook for 1 minute, stirring constantly. Stir in wine, tomatoes, and kidney beans; bring to a boil. Cover, reduce heat, and simmer 1 hour, stirring occasionally. Uncover and cook for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ally. Discard the bay leaves. Sprinkle each serving with cheddar cheese. Serving Size (about 1 1/4 cup) Per Serving: 366 Calories; 9g Fat (22.9% calories from fat); 3g Saturated Fat; 27g Protein; 41g Carbohydrate; 9g Dietary Fiber; 63mg Cholesterol; 1207mg Sodium.
